Output 83eb245ff85ad781bdbbb798b207ef36df4161fa52f4a1a4661e3d4ca0c79583:1

value
40658670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 634be9251c39061e49bca014fdf33759cfcd3897 OP_EQUALVERIFY OP_CHECKSIG
address
LUGz6aE9YW2MCBiooMa9tNnhMY2DMbbjNZ
transaction
83eb245ff85ad781bdbbb798b207ef36df4161fa52f4a1a4661e3d4ca0c79583
spent
true